    When it comes to determining how far you should hit your 9 iron, it’s important to recognize that there isn’t a one-size-fits-all distance. While manufacturers often list average carry distances-typically around 125 to 140 yards for a 9 iron-these are broad generalizations that don’t fully capture individual variables. Each golfer’s swing speed, technique, and even the type of golf ball used significantly influence how far the ball will travel. For example, a player with a faster swing speed and solid contact might reach beyond the average, while a beginner with a slower swing might fall short of that range.

    Physical stature and experience also play crucial roles. Taller, stronger players often generate greater clubhead speed, which translates to longer shots. Conversely, weather conditions like wind, temperature, and humidity can either enhance or reduce distance. Hitting uphill or into the wind usually shortens the effective range, whereas downhill shots or tailwinds can increase it.

    Terrain and course conditions, such as elevation changes, firmness of the turf, and type of grass, further complicate distance expectations. Soft fairways will absorb more ball impact, reducing rollout, whereas firm conditions promote extra roll.

    Knowing your ideal 9 iron distance is valuable not only for distance control but also for accuracy. By consistently practicing and measuring your shot distances in various conditions, you gain a reliable benchmark. This consistency helps optimize club selection, shot planning, and course management. Ultimately, metrics like average carry, dispersion patterns, and strike quality should be evaluated to gauge both distance and reliability. For every aspiring golfer, understanding these factors is indeed fundamental to improving their game.

    When deciding how much to invest in golf clubs, it’s crucial to first assess your personal goals and level of commitment to the sport. For beginners who are just exploring golf, more affordable sets or even secondhand clubs can be a practical starting point. They allow you to learn the fundamentals without a significant financial outlay. However, if you’re an aspiring golfer dedicated to improving your skills and possibly competing, investing in higher-quality clubs designed with advanced technology and precision craftsmanship can offer better performance and consistency on the course.

    Quality should always be a key criterion when comparing brands and models. Premium clubs often use superior materials, such as forged steel or titanium, and feature modern design enhancements that can improve trajectory, distance, and forgiveness for off-center hits. That said, spending excessively on clubs isn’t always synonymous with better play, especially if the equipment doesn’t fit your swing or you haven’t yet mastered the mechanics. Custom fitting can help strike this balance, ensuring your clubs match your physical attributes and playing style.

    Regarding complete sets versus individual clubs, beginners might find full sets convenient and cost-effective, while more experienced players often prefer choosing specific clubs tailored to their needs. Additionally, considering factors like comfort, durability, and potential for future upgrades can extend the lifespan of your investment.

    Ultimately, the best approach is to align your budget with realistic expectations about your golfing journey. Prioritize clubs that feel right for you, encourage your development, and bring enjoyment-after all, golf is as much about the experience as the gear.

    When determining the optimal duration for treadmill workouts, it’s critical to consider a blend of personal and external factors rather than relying solely on endurance levels. Fitness goals play a pivotal role; for example, someone aiming to improve cardiovascular health may focus on longer, moderate-intensity sessions, while individuals targeting weight loss might benefit from shorter, high-intensity interval training (HIIT) bouts. Age and health conditions cannot be overlooked-older adults or those with chronic conditions should often start with shorter, low-impact workouts to reduce injury risk and gradually increase duration as stamina and confidence build.

    Beginners ideally should commence with shorter sessions, perhaps 10 to 15 minutes, allowing their bodies to adapt while minimizing overwhelm or injury. Gradual increments of 5-minute additions weekly help foster consistency and progress without burnout. A sudden long-duration workout can be counterproductive and potentially harmful.

    Speed and incline adjustments significantly impact the overall duration and intensity. Higher speeds and steeper inclines elevate exertion, potentially shortening ideal workout time but increasing cardiovascular and muscular benefits. Interval training, alternating periods of high and low intensity, can maximize workout efficiency in less time, boosting aerobic capacity and fat burning. Maintaining a steady pace, however, aids endurance and mental focus, beneficial for those training for longer-duration events.

    Striking a balance between maximizing cardiovascular benefits and avoiding injury involves listening to one’s body, incorporating rest days, and combining varied training elements. Fitness professionals recommend tailoring treadmill routines around individual fitness assessments, gradually scaling intensity, and incorporating cross-training for comprehensive fitness. Ultimately, personalization-aligned with goals, capabilities, and feedback-is key to a successful treadmill regimen.

    When deciding whether to wear an ankle brace all day, it’s important to carefully weigh the benefits against the potential drawbacks. If you experience ongoing pain or instability, a brace can provide valuable support, reducing the risk of further injury, especially during physical activity. However, wearing a brace continuously without medical guidance could limit your ankle’s natural movement, potentially leading to muscle weakening or atrophy over time. The type of brace you choose matters as well-rigid braces offer maximum support but may restrict mobility, while elastic or semi-rigid braces allow more movement and might be better suited for extended wear.

    Consider the specific activities you engage in daily. For example, during high-impact sports or long periods of standing, wearing a brace can enhance stability and confidence. In contrast, if you are mostly sedentary, prolonged brace use might be unnecessary and even counterproductive. Consulting with a healthcare professional is crucial; they can assess your ankle’s condition, advise on appropriate brace types, and recommend a wearing schedule that supports healing without creating dependence.

    Long-term use of an ankle brace should ideally be part of a comprehensive recovery plan including strengthening exercises, rather than a standalone solution. This approach helps maintain muscle tone and joint flexibility while protecting the ankle. In summary, while ankle braces provide essential support in certain situations, balanced use and professional input are key to preserving your ankle’s health and function over time.

    When faced with a persistent cough, deciding whether to seek urgent care can indeed be challenging. It’s important first to assess both the duration and severity of your symptoms. A cough lasting more than three weeks or worsening over time should never be ignored, as it might signal an underlying condition such as bronchitis, pneumonia, or even more serious respiratory illnesses. Additionally, accompanying symptoms like high fever, difficulty breathing, chest pain, or coughing up blood are clear indicators that immediate medical attention is warranted.

    Many times, a cough is caused by seasonal allergies or a common cold, which tend to resolve on their own without urgent intervention. However, differentiating between benign causes and more serious issues can be tricky without professional evaluation. Urgent care centers offer timely access to healthcare professionals who can perform a physical examination, order necessary tests like chest X-rays, and provide immediate treatment or referrals. This can be especially beneficial if your primary care provider isn’t immediately available.

    Ignoring persistent or worsening cough symptoms may lead to complications or delayed diagnosis of serious conditions. Untreated infections or other respiratory problems can escalate, potentially resulting in hospitalization or chronic health issues. Therefore, seeking evaluation sooner rather than later ensures that you receive appropriate care, avoid unnecessary complications, and gain peace of mind.

    In summary, if your cough is persistent, severe, or accompanied by troubling symptoms, visiting urgent care is a prudent step. It helps ensure timely diagnosis and treatment, potentially preventing more serious health problems down the line.

    As a homeowner in Wisconsin, determining the optimal fertilizer schedule for your lawn requires careful consideration of the state’s distinct climate and seasonal variations. Wisconsin’s cold winters and warm summers mean your lawn goes through periods of dormancy and active growth, which significantly influence when fertilization will be most effective. Typically, the best times to fertilize are during the early spring and early fall. In spring, once soil temperatures consistently reach around 55°F, your grass enters active growth and can efficiently utilize nutrients. Fall fertilization, especially in late September to early October, supports root development and helps the lawn store energy to survive the winter.

    Monitoring soil moisture is also critical. Applying fertilizer when the soil is moist, but not overly saturated, ensures nutrients are absorbed and reduces runoff risk. Dry conditions or frozen ground can prevent nutrients from penetrating the soil and reaching roots, diminishing the fertilization’s effectiveness.

    Considering different fertilizer types is equally important. A slow-release nitrogen fertilizer applied in fall encourages deep root growth and prepares your lawn for spring. In contrast, a fertilizer higher in nitrogen in spring promotes vibrant shoot growth. Additionally, regional variations within Wisconsin-such as the cooling effect near Lake Michigan versus the warmer southern areas-can influence timing and fertilizer choice.

    Consulting local resources, like the University of Wisconsin Extension or experienced landscapers, can provide personalized advice tailored to your lawn’s specific conditions. Adjusting your strategy in response to changing weather patterns, such as delayed springs or wet falls, will help maintain a healthy, resilient lawn year-round. Overall, understanding your lawn’s seasonal needs in relation to Wisconsin’s climate ensures you fertilize at the most propitious times for optimal growth.

    Feeding chickens for optimal growth and health requires a nuanced approach tailored to several factors including age, breed, and production purpose. Generally, chicks need frequent feeding-every 2-3 hours during the first week-since their rapid development and small crops demand constant nourishment. As they mature, feeding two to three times daily suffices, with access to fresh water and feed ad libitum often recommended for laying hens and meat birds alike.

    Breed and purpose significantly influence dietary needs. Layers require calcium-rich feeds to support eggshell production, whereas meat birds benefit from higher protein diets for muscle growth. Timetables should therefore align with these nutritional goals rather than being rigid. Seasonal changes also impact feeding: colder months may increase energy demands to maintain body temperature, necessitating higher caloric intake, while warmer periods might reduce appetite.

    Regarding feed types, grain-based and organic feeds differ in nutrient profiles and potential additives. Organic feeds may support better gut health and reduce chemical exposure, potentially improving overall well-being, but might be costlier. Both types can support healthy growth if balanced properly.

    Feeding frequency matters; multiple smaller meals can prevent digestive overload and reduce competition among flock members. Communal dynamics are important-dominant birds may monopolize feed, so ensuring enough feeder space and observing intake can prevent undernourished individuals.

    Signs to watch include consistent weight gain, bright eyes, active behavior, and productive laying in hens. Comparing established guidelines with anecdotal experiences helps refine practices, as local conditions and individual flocks vary. Combining scientific recommendations with practical adjustments leads to the best outcomes.

    Your question about the optimal frequency of pore strip use addresses a common and important concern for many seeking clearer skin. There truly isn’t a universal answer because individual skin types and conditions vary significantly. Generally, using pore strips once every one to two weeks is recommended to avoid over-stripping the skin, which can lead to irritation, dryness, or even exacerbate acne and sensitivity.

    Your point about considering skin oiliness and chronic conditions like acne is crucial. Oily skin might tolerate pore strips a bit more frequently than dry or sensitive skin, but even then, moderation is key. For those with acne-prone or inflamed skin, pore strips could potentially worsen breakouts by disrupting the skin barrier or causing micro-tears. In such cases, gentler alternatives like chemical exfoliants or professional treatments might be better.

    Seasonal changes can affect skin texture and oil production, meaning you might adjust frequency accordingly-for example, less often in winter when skin tends to be drier. Also, the formulation of different brands matters; pore strips with added soothing ingredients (like aloe vera) might be gentler, whereas harsh adhesives should be used sparingly.

    Ultimately, consulting a dermatologist can offer personalized guidance, ensuring your method complements your broader skincare regimen without causing harm. A balanced, moderate approach-listening to your skin’s response, not overusing pore strips, and integrating moisturizing and calming products-will yield the best long-term results.
